* WHAT...Flooding caused by excessive rainfall is expected.
* WHERE...A portion of southwest Virginia, including the following
counties and independent city, Carroll, City of Galax and Grayson.
* WHEN...Until 115 AM EDT.
* IMPACTS...Minor flooding in low-lying and poor drainage areas.
Ponding of water in urban or other areas is occurring or is
imminent.
* ADDITIONAL DETAILS...
- At 1014 PM EDT, Doppler radar indicated heavy rain due to
thunderstorms. Minor flooding is ongoing or expected to begin
shortly in the advisory area. Up to 1.5 inches of rain have
fallen.
- This includes the following streams and drainages...
Piney Creek, Dixon Branch, Mill Creek, Oglesby Branch,
Chestnut Creek, Little Cranberry Creek, New River, Crooked
Creek and Glady Fork.
Additional rainfall amounts up to 1 inch are expected over
the area. This additional rain will result in minor flooding.
- Some locations that will experience flooding include...
Galax... Fries...
